R6 LNM is a 2004 Yamaha R6 in Red with a 599c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70.6%.
Across all 2004 Yamaha R6 models, the average MOT pass rate is 83.1% with a typical mileage of 15,071 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Yamaha R6 fails its MOT is reflector on motorcycle missing, accounting for 1,205 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R6 LNM,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Yamaha R6 typ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 22 years old, this Yamaha R6 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
